mysql删除一行数据

mysql删除一行数据

mysql删除一行数据

在使用MySQL数据库时,经常会遇到需要删除一行数据的情况。删除数据是数据库操作中非常重要的一个功能,因此掌握如何删除数据是数据库操作的基础之一。本文将详细介绍如何在MySQL数据库中删除一行数据。

删除一行数据的语法

要删除一行数据,可以使用DELETE语句,其基本语法如下:

DELETE FROM table_name WHERE condition;

其中,table_name是要删除数据的表名,condition是用来指定删除条件的表达式。如果不指定条件,则会删除表中的所有数据;如果指定条件,则只会删除符合条件的行数据。

删除一行数据的示例

假设有一个名为students的表,包含学生的学号(id)、姓名(name)和年龄(age)字段。现在我们要删除学号为1001的学生数据,可以使用以下语句:

DELETE FROM students WHERE id = 1001;

运行上述SQL语句后,表中学号为1001的学生数据将被删除。

删除所有数据

如果想要一次性删除表中所有数据,可以简单地使用以下语句:

DELETE FROM students;

该语句会删除表中所有数据,但不会删除表本身。

删除数据的注意事项

在使用DELETE语句删除数据时,需要注意一些事项,以避免出错或误删数据:

  1. 注意条件表达式

    确保使用条件表达式准确无误,以确保只删除需要删除的数据。在操作时,最好先在测试环境进行测试,避免直接在生产环境删除数据。

  2. 备份数据

    在删除数据之前,最好先备份数据,以防删除数据后需要恢复。可以使用MySQL提供的数据导出工具或者直接备份数据文件的方式进行数据备份。

  3. 谨慎使用不带条件的删除语句

    在不带条件的情况下删除数据会清空整个表,因此需要谨慎使用,避免造成数据丢失。

通过本文的介绍,相信大家已经掌握了如何在MySQL数据库中删除一行数据的方法和注意事项。在实际操作中,务必谨慎对待数据的删除操作,以避免造成不必要的损失。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程